What is the longest anime season ever?

Adapted from the manga of the same name, Sazae-san is by far the longest-running anime series of all time, with over 2500 episodes to date. Beginning in 1969, Sazae-san remains on the air each Sunday evening to this day. The show follows Sazae Fuguta and her family.

How many episodes of Kirin Monoshiri Yakata?

7 Kirin Monoshiri Yakata - 1565 Episodes. This children's educational program featured a cat named Cathy and trying to get along with a mouse while teaching history to children. It aired originally from 1975 to 1984.

What is the story of Nobita and the Doraemon?

The story follows the adventures of Nobita and the titular robot Doraemon as he tries to guide his young ward to make better choices so his descendants in the future won't live in poverty. Doraemon's four-dimensional pocket leads to many odd and endearing scenarios as just about anything can appear from it.

What is the time travel trope in Prince Mackaroo?

Time travel is a classic trope in shows, and Prince Mackaroo uses it well. A young noble named Ojarumaru manages to transport himself into the present era from over 1000 years in the past using a magical stick from the demon king Enma. He becomes friends with a young boy named Kazuma and joins his family in the future.

How many episodes are there in Whys of Blue Cat?

2 3000 Whys Of Blue Cat (Lan Mao) - 3057 Episodes. Lan Mao, also known as Blue Cat, is Chinese educational series that first premiered back in 1999 and is among the longest-running children's shows of all time. Produced by Beijing Sunchime Happy Culture Company, the series has inspired over 400 books, a theme park, ...

Why is Astro Boy so popular?

The sole reason why ‘Astro Boy’ is on this list is because of how it revolutionized the whole world of American cartoons when it first premiered in 1963. It’s basically a cute series that involves a lot of satire comedy which was appealing to both teenagers and kids back in the day. ‘Astro Boy’ is one anime that will be a favorite to kids of many generations in the future and if you happen to be an adult who watched it as a kid, this one can bring back some pleasant childhood memories for you.

What is Monogatari anime?

The Monogatari series is the definition of an acquired taste and should be tried by anyone looking to experience a different type of anime. An adaptation of Nisio Isin's light novel series, Monogatari is split into separate seasons revolving around Koyomi Araragi's run-ins with supernatural-themed cases typically involving high school girls.

How many episodes are there in Natsume's book of friends?

Split into six seasons lasting roughly 13 episodes each, Natsume's Book of Friends is a quaint supernatural slice of life anime that centers around the titular boy's attempts to free the spirits who are subservient to The Book of Friends.
